How much do entry level tech j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 21,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level tech in Waltham, MA is $21.12,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.58 and $23.85 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an entry level tech do?

Entry Level Techs often start by assisting with hardware and software installations, troubleshooting basic technical issues, and supporting end-users with routine IT questions. They may also be involved in setting up new equipment, performing regular system maintenance, and documenting technical procedures. Collaboration with more experienced technicians and IT teams is common, providing opportunities to learn best practices and gradually take on more complex tasks as confidence and skills develop.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level tech,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Tech, you need a basic understanding of computer hardware, software troubleshooting, and networking concepts, typically supported by a high school diploma or associate degree. Familiarity with operating systems, ticketing systems, and certifications like CompTIA A+ are often beneficial.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ication set candidates apart in this role. These skills ensure you can efficiently support users, resolve technical issues, and contribute to a smooth IT environment.

What is the difference between Entry Level Tech vs Network Technician?

AspectEntry Level TechNetwork Technician
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; certifications like CompTIA A+High school diploma; certifications like CompTIA Network+ or Cisco CCNA
Work EnvironmentIT support, help desk, hardware setupNetwork setup, troubleshooting, infrastructure maintenance
Employer & Industry UsageIT departments, tech support companiesTelecommunications, enterprise IT, data centers

Entry Level Tech roles typically focus on basic hardware and software support, requiring foundational certifications. Network Technicians specialize in network infrastructure, often needing specific networking certifications. Both roles are common in IT environments, but Network Technicians usually handle more specialized networking tasks.

How can I get a job in entry level tech with no experience?

Entry level tech positions often require basic knowledge of computer hardware, software, or networking, which can be gained through online courses, certifications like CompTIA A+ or Network+, and hands-on practice. Building a strong resume that highlights problem-solving skills, willingness to learn, and relevant certifications can improve your chances of securing an entry-level role without prior experience.

What is the easiest entry level tech job?

An entry-level tech job such as a help desk technician or IT support specialist is often considered one of the easiest to start, requiring basic computer skills, troubleshooting abilities, and sometimes certifications like CompTIA A+. These roles typically involve assisting users with hardware and software issues and may require minimal prior experience.

As an Automotive Technician, you will provide superior automotive service including engine analysis, fuel injection, steering/ suspension, exhaust, and computer-controlled systems, along with struts, shocks, cooling/heating, brakes, and other important service needs.

The Auto Technician should understand under-hood mechanics and undercarriage assemblies. Based on your ability and willingness to learn, you will have the opportunity to advance to other key service-oriented positions within the company.

Experienced technicians must have a high school diploma or GED, a valid driver's license, and tools. OEM/ASE certifications are a must. A-level/Master automotive technicians must possess the proficiency to execute comprehensive diagnostics and repairs across various automotive systems.

Entry level tech must have a valid driver's license, high school diploma, GED, or in process of completing high school, and a reliable form of transportation.
